Jeddah Airport aims at strengthening its hub status

6th July, 2007

Until late 2005, Saudi Arabian General Authority of Civil Aviation

(GACA) was a typical service oriented government department dependant on state

funding to manage and operate all of its 27 international, regional and domestic

airports in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. However, in 2006, GACA became a self-autonomous,

corporatised organisation with a view to be fully commercialised within ten
